Difference between revisions of "Template:SMW Type"
Jump to navigation
Jump to search
(created by WikiTask 2017-10-03T17:24:42Z) |
m (created by WikiTask 2019-10-11T04:56:16Z) |
||
Line 1: | Line 1: | ||
<noinclude> | <noinclude> | ||
<!-- | <!-- | ||
− | -- Copyright (C) 2015- | + | -- Copyright (C) 2015-2019 BITPlan GmbH |
-- | -- | ||
-- Pater-Delp-Str. -- 1 | -- Pater-Delp-Str. -- 1 | ||
Line 18: | Line 18: | ||
|type= | |type= | ||
|documentation= | |documentation= | ||
+ | |id= | ||
|helppage= | |helppage= | ||
|typepage= | |typepage= | ||
Line 30: | Line 31: | ||
|type= | |type= | ||
|documentation= | |documentation= | ||
+ | |id= | ||
|helppage= | |helppage= | ||
|typepage= | |typepage= | ||
Line 42: | Line 44: | ||
|type= | |type= | ||
|documentation= | |documentation= | ||
+ | |id= | ||
|helppage= | |helppage= | ||
|typepage= | |typepage= | ||
Line 55: | Line 58: | ||
|type= | |type= | ||
|documentation= | |documentation= | ||
+ | |id= | ||
|helppage= | |helppage= | ||
|typepage= | |typepage= | ||
Line 67: | Line 71: | ||
|type= | |type= | ||
|documentation= | |documentation= | ||
+ | |id= | ||
|helppage= | |helppage= | ||
|typepage= | |typepage= | ||
Line 79: | Line 84: | ||
|type= | |type= | ||
|documentation= | |documentation= | ||
+ | |id= | ||
|helppage= | |helppage= | ||
|typepage= | |typepage= | ||
Line 91: | Line 97: | ||
|type= | |type= | ||
|documentation= | |documentation= | ||
+ | |id= | ||
|helppage= | |helppage= | ||
|typepage= | |typepage= | ||
Line 104: | Line 111: | ||
{{#if:{{{?type|}}}|"{{{?type}}}" is type of it <br>|}} | {{#if:{{{?type|}}}|"{{{?type}}}" is type of it <br>|}} | ||
{{#if:{{{?documentation|}}}|"{{{?documentation}}}" is documentation of it <br>|}} | {{#if:{{{?documentation|}}}|"{{{?documentation}}}" is documentation of it <br>|}} | ||
+ | {{#if:{{{?id|}}}|"{{{?id}}}" is id of it <br>|}} | ||
{{#if:{{{?helppage|}}}|"{{{?helppage}}}" is helppage of it <br>|}} | {{#if:{{{?helppage|}}}|"{{{?helppage}}}" is helppage of it <br>|}} | ||
{{#if:{{{?typepage|}}}|"{{{?typepage}}}" is typepage of it <br>|}} | {{#if:{{{?typepage|}}}|"{{{?typepage}}}" is typepage of it <br>|}} | ||
Line 114: | Line 122: | ||
|SMW_Type type={{{type|}}} | |SMW_Type type={{{type|}}} | ||
|SMW_Type documentation={{{documentation|}}} | |SMW_Type documentation={{{documentation|}}} | ||
+ | |SMW_Type id={{{id|}}} | ||
|SMW_Type helppage={{{helppage|}}} | |SMW_Type helppage={{{helppage|}}} | ||
|SMW_Type typepage={{{typepage|}}} | |SMW_Type typepage={{{typepage|}}} | ||
Line 123: | Line 132: | ||
|SMW_Type type={{{type|}}} | |SMW_Type type={{{type|}}} | ||
|SMW_Type documentation={{{documentation|}}} | |SMW_Type documentation={{{documentation|}}} | ||
+ | |SMW_Type id={{{id|}}} | ||
|SMW_Type helppage={{{helppage|}}} | |SMW_Type helppage={{{helppage|}}} | ||
|SMW_Type typepage={{{typepage|}}} | |SMW_Type typepage={{{typepage|}}} | ||
Line 130: | Line 140: | ||
}} | }} | ||
{{#switch: {{{viewmode|}}} | {{#switch: {{{viewmode|}}} | ||
+ | |hidden= | ||
|masterdetail= | |masterdetail= | ||
|tableheader={{{!}} class='wikitable' | |tableheader={{{!}} class='wikitable' | ||
− | !type!!documentation!!helppage!!typepage!!javaType!!usedByProperties | + | !type!!documentation!!id!!helppage!!typepage!!javaType!!usedByProperties |
{{!}}- | {{!}}- | ||
|tablerow= | |tablerow= | ||
− | {{!}}{{{type|}}}{{!}}{{!}}{{{documentation|}}}{{!}}{{!}}{{{helppage|}}}{{!}}{{!}}{{{typepage|}}}{{!}}{{!}}{{{javaType|}}}{{!}}{{!}}{{{usedByProperties|}}} | + | {{!}}{{{type|}}}{{!}}{{!}}{{{documentation|}}}{{!}}{{!}}{{{id|}}}{{!}}{{!}}{{{helppage|}}}{{!}}{{!}}{{{typepage|}}}{{!}}{{!}}{{{javaType|}}}{{!}}{{!}}{{{usedByProperties|}}} |
{{!}}- | {{!}}- | ||
|tablefooter={{!}}} | |tablefooter={{!}}} | ||
|labelfield= | |labelfield= | ||
− | type={{#if:{{{type|}}}|{{{type|}}}|}}<br>documentation={{#if:{{{documentation|}}}|{{{documentation|}}}|}}<br>helppage={{#if:{{{helppage|}}}|{{{helppage|}}}|}}<br>typepage={{#if:{{{typepage|}}}|[[{{{typepage|}}}]]|}}<br>javaType={{#if:{{{javaType|}}}|{{{javaType|}}}|}}<br>usedByProperties={{#if:{{{usedByProperties|}}}|[[{{{usedByProperties|}}}]]|}}<br>|#default={{{!}} class='wikitable' | + | type={{#if:{{{type|}}}|{{{type|}}}|}}<br>documentation={{#if:{{{documentation|}}}|{{{documentation|}}}|}}<br>id={{#if:{{{id|}}}|{{{id|}}}|}}<br>helppage={{#if:{{{helppage|}}}|{{{helppage|}}}|}}<br>typepage={{#if:{{{typepage|}}}|[[{{{typepage|}}}]]|}}<br>javaType={{#if:{{{javaType|}}}|{{{javaType|}}}|}}<br>usedByProperties={{#if:{{{usedByProperties|}}}|[[{{{usedByProperties|}}}]]|}}<br>|#default={{{!}} class='wikitable' |
! colspan='2' {{!}}SMW_Type | ! colspan='2' {{!}}SMW_Type | ||
{{!}}- | {{!}}- | ||
Line 149: | Line 160: | ||
{{!}} {{#if:{{{type|}}}|{{{type|}}}|}} | {{!}} {{#if:{{{type|}}}|{{{type|}}}|}} | ||
{{!}}- | {{!}}- | ||
− | ! | + | !documentation |
{{!}} {{#if:{{{documentation|}}}|{{{documentation|}}}|}} | {{!}} {{#if:{{{documentation|}}}|{{{documentation|}}}|}} | ||
{{!}}- | {{!}}- | ||
− | ! | + | !id |
+ | {{!}} {{#if:{{{id|}}}|{{{id|}}}|}} | ||
+ | {{!}}- | ||
+ | !helppage | ||
{{!}} {{#if:{{{helppage|}}}|{{{helppage|}}}|}} | {{!}} {{#if:{{{helppage|}}}|{{{helppage|}}}|}} | ||
{{!}}- | {{!}}- | ||
Line 176: | Line 190: | ||
{{#if:{{{?type|}}}|"{{{?type}}}" is type of it <br>|}} | {{#if:{{{?type|}}}|"{{{?type}}}" is type of it <br>|}} | ||
{{#if:{{{?documentation|}}}|"{{{?documentation}}}" is documentation of it <br>|}} | {{#if:{{{?documentation|}}}|"{{{?documentation}}}" is documentation of it <br>|}} | ||
+ | {{#if:{{{?id|}}}|"{{{?id}}}" is id of it <br>|}} | ||
{{#if:{{{?helppage|}}}|"{{{?helppage}}}" is helppage of it <br>|}} | {{#if:{{{?helppage|}}}|"{{{?helppage}}}" is helppage of it <br>|}} | ||
{{#if:{{{?typepage|}}}|"{{{?typepage}}}" is typepage of it <br>|}} | {{#if:{{{?typepage|}}}|"{{{?typepage}}}" is typepage of it <br>|}} | ||
Line 186: | Line 201: | ||
|SMW_Type type={{{type|}}} | |SMW_Type type={{{type|}}} | ||
|SMW_Type documentation={{{documentation|}}} | |SMW_Type documentation={{{documentation|}}} | ||
+ | |SMW_Type id={{{id|}}} | ||
|SMW_Type helppage={{{helppage|}}} | |SMW_Type helppage={{{helppage|}}} | ||
|SMW_Type typepage={{{typepage|}}} | |SMW_Type typepage={{{typepage|}}} | ||
Line 195: | Line 211: | ||
|SMW_Type type={{{type|}}} | |SMW_Type type={{{type|}}} | ||
|SMW_Type documentation={{{documentation|}}} | |SMW_Type documentation={{{documentation|}}} | ||
+ | |SMW_Type id={{{id|}}} | ||
|SMW_Type helppage={{{helppage|}}} | |SMW_Type helppage={{{helppage|}}} | ||
|SMW_Type typepage={{{typepage|}}} | |SMW_Type typepage={{{typepage|}}} | ||
Line 202: | Line 219: | ||
}} | }} | ||
{{#switch: {{{viewmode|}}} | {{#switch: {{{viewmode|}}} | ||
+ | |hidden= | ||
|masterdetail= | |masterdetail= | ||
|tableheader={{{!}} class='wikitable' | |tableheader={{{!}} class='wikitable' | ||
− | !type!!documentation!!helppage!!typepage!!javaType!!usedByProperties | + | !type!!documentation!!id!!helppage!!typepage!!javaType!!usedByProperties |
{{!}}- | {{!}}- | ||
|tablerow= | |tablerow= | ||
− | {{!}}{{{type|}}}{{!}}{{!}}{{{documentation|}}}{{!}}{{!}}{{{helppage|}}}{{!}}{{!}}{{{typepage|}}}{{!}}{{!}}{{{javaType|}}}{{!}}{{!}}{{{usedByProperties|}}} | + | {{!}}{{{type|}}}{{!}}{{!}}{{{documentation|}}}{{!}}{{!}}{{{id|}}}{{!}}{{!}}{{{helppage|}}}{{!}}{{!}}{{{typepage|}}}{{!}}{{!}}{{{javaType|}}}{{!}}{{!}}{{{usedByProperties|}}} |
{{!}}- | {{!}}- | ||
|tablefooter={{!}}} | |tablefooter={{!}}} | ||
|labelfield= | |labelfield= | ||
− | type={{#if:{{{type|}}}|{{{type|}}}|}}<br>documentation={{#if:{{{documentation|}}}|{{{documentation|}}}|}}<br>helppage={{#if:{{{helppage|}}}|{{{helppage|}}}|}}<br>typepage={{#if:{{{typepage|}}}|[[{{{typepage|}}}]]|}}<br>javaType={{#if:{{{javaType|}}}|{{{javaType|}}}|}}<br>usedByProperties={{#if:{{{usedByProperties|}}}|[[{{{usedByProperties|}}}]]|}}<br>|#default={{{!}} class='wikitable' | + | type={{#if:{{{type|}}}|{{{type|}}}|}}<br>documentation={{#if:{{{documentation|}}}|{{{documentation|}}}|}}<br>id={{#if:{{{id|}}}|{{{id|}}}|}}<br>helppage={{#if:{{{helppage|}}}|{{{helppage|}}}|}}<br>typepage={{#if:{{{typepage|}}}|[[{{{typepage|}}}]]|}}<br>javaType={{#if:{{{javaType|}}}|{{{javaType|}}}|}}<br>usedByProperties={{#if:{{{usedByProperties|}}}|[[{{{usedByProperties|}}}]]|}}<br>|#default={{{!}} class='wikitable' |
! colspan='2' {{!}}SMW_Type | ! colspan='2' {{!}}SMW_Type | ||
{{!}}- | {{!}}- | ||
Line 221: | Line 239: | ||
{{!}} {{#if:{{{type|}}}|{{{type|}}}|}} | {{!}} {{#if:{{{type|}}}|{{{type|}}}|}} | ||
{{!}}- | {{!}}- | ||
− | ! | + | !documentation |
{{!}} {{#if:{{{documentation|}}}|{{{documentation|}}}|}} | {{!}} {{#if:{{{documentation|}}}|{{{documentation|}}}|}} | ||
{{!}}- | {{!}}- | ||
− | ! | + | !id |
+ | {{!}} {{#if:{{{id|}}}|{{{id|}}}|}} | ||
+ | {{!}}- | ||
+ | !helppage | ||
{{!}} {{#if:{{{helppage|}}}|{{{helppage|}}}|}} | {{!}} {{#if:{{{helppage|}}}|{{{helppage|}}}|}} | ||
{{!}}- | {{!}}- |
Latest revision as of 05:56, 11 October 2019
This is the template SMW_Type.
It belongs to the concept/topic Concept:SMW_Type
You may find examples for the use of this template via the List of SMW_Types.
Usage
storemode subobject
{{SMW_Type |type= |documentation= |id= |helppage= |typepage= |javaType= |usedByProperties= |storemode=subobject }}
storemode property
{{SMW_Type |type= |documentation= |id= |helppage= |typepage= |javaType= |usedByProperties= |storemode=property }}
storemode none
{{SMW_Type |type= |documentation= |id= |helppage= |typepage= |javaType= |usedByProperties= |storemode=none }}
viewmode tableheader
{{SMW_Type |type= |documentation= |id= |helppage= |typepage= |javaType= |usedByProperties= |viewmode=tableheader }}
viewmode tablerow
{{SMW_Type |type= |documentation= |id= |helppage= |typepage= |javaType= |usedByProperties= |viewmode=tablerow }}
{{SMW_Type |type= |documentation= |id= |helppage= |typepage= |javaType= |usedByProperties= |viewmode=tablefooter }}
viewmode labelfield
{{SMW_Type |type= |documentation= |id= |helppage= |typepage= |javaType= |usedByProperties= |viewmode=labelfield }}
Source (pretty printed)
{{#switch:{{{userparam|}}}|sidif={{#if:{{{?pageid|}}}|{{#replace:{{#replace:{{{?pageid}}}|#|}}|-|_}} isA SMW_Type<br>|}}
{{#if:{{{?type|}}}|"{{{?type}}}" is type of it <br>|}}
{{#if:{{{?documentation|}}}|"{{{?documentation}}}" is documentation of it <br>|}}
{{#if:{{{?id|}}}|"{{{?id}}}" is id of it <br>|}}
{{#if:{{{?helppage|}}}|"{{{?helppage}}}" is helppage of it <br>|}}
{{#if:{{{?typepage|}}}|"{{{?typepage}}}" is typepage of it <br>|}}
{{#if:{{{?javaType|}}}|"{{{?javaType}}}" is javaType of it <br>|}}
{{#if:{{{?usedByProperties|}}}|"{{{?usedByProperties}}}" is usedByProperties of it <br>|}}
|#default={{#switch:{{{storemode|}}}
|none=
|subobject={{#subobject:-
|isA=SMW_Type
|SMW_Type type={{{type|}}}
|SMW_Type documentation={{{documentation|}}}
|SMW_Type id={{{id|}}}
|SMW_Type helppage={{{helppage|}}}
|SMW_Type typepage={{{typepage|}}}
|SMW_Type javaType={{{javaType|}}}
|SMW_Type usedByProperties={{{usedByProperties|}}}
}}
|#default={{#set:
|isA=SMW_Type
|SMW_Type type={{{type|}}}
|SMW_Type documentation={{{documentation|}}}
|SMW_Type id={{{id|}}}
|SMW_Type helppage={{{helppage|}}}
|SMW_Type typepage={{{typepage|}}}
|SMW_Type javaType={{{javaType|}}}
|SMW_Type usedByProperties={{{usedByProperties|}}}
}}
}}
{{#switch: {{{viewmode|}}}
|hidden=
|masterdetail=
|tableheader={{{!}} class='wikitable'
!type!!documentation!!id!!helppage!!typepage!!javaType!!usedByProperties
{{!}}-
|tablerow=
{{!}}{{{type|}}}{{!}}{{!}}{{{documentation|}}}{{!}}{{!}}{{{id|}}}{{!}}{{!}}{{{helppage|}}}{{!}}{{!}}{{{typepage|}}}{{!}}{{!}}{{{javaType|}}}{{!}}{{!}}{{{usedByProperties|}}}
{{!}}-
|tablefooter={{!}}}
|labelfield=
type={{#if:{{{type|}}}|{{{type|}}}|}}<br>documentation={{#if:{{{documentation|}}}|{{{documentation|}}}|}}<br>id={{#if:{{{id|}}}|{{{id|}}}|}}<br>helppage={{#if:{{{helppage|}}}|{{{helppage|}}}|}}<br>typepage={{#if:{{{typepage|}}}|[[{{{typepage|}}}]]|}}<br>javaType={{#if:{{{javaType|}}}|{{{javaType|}}}|}}<br>usedByProperties={{#if:{{{usedByProperties|}}}|[[{{{usedByProperties|}}}]]|}}<br>|#default={{{!}} class='wikitable'
! colspan='2' {{!}}SMW_Type
{{!}}-
{{#switch:{{{storemode|}}}|property=
! colspan='2' style='text-align:left' {{!}} {{Icon|name=edit|size=24}}{{Link|target=Special:FormEdit/SMW_Type/{{FULLPAGENAME}}|title=edit}}
{{!}}-
}}
!type
{{!}} {{#if:{{{type|}}}|{{{type|}}}|}}
{{!}}-
!documentation
{{!}} {{#if:{{{documentation|}}}|{{{documentation|}}}|}}
{{!}}-
!id
{{!}} {{#if:{{{id|}}}|{{{id|}}}|}}
{{!}}-
!helppage
{{!}} {{#if:{{{helppage|}}}|{{{helppage|}}}|}}
{{!}}-
!typepage
{{!}} {{#if:{{{typepage|}}}|[[{{{typepage|}}}]]|}}
{{!}}-
!java Type
{{!}} {{#if:{{{javaType|}}}|{{{javaType|}}}|}}
{{!}}-
!usedByProperties
{{!}} {{#if:{{{usedByProperties|}}}|[[{{{usedByProperties|}}}]]|}}
{{!}}-
{{!}}}
}}
}}
Source
Click on "Edit" to edit the noinclude-part Source of this Template.